Policy

  • The acquisition of a non-capital asset must be in accordance with the FMPM 710: Policy – Purchasing.

  • The Organisational Unit controlling the non-capital asset must ensure that the asset is:

    • properly maintained in order to maximise the period of effective use;

    • protected from loss; and

    • deployed in an effective and efficient manner.

  • A non-capital asset must not be used for private purposes by an employee unless approved by the Head of the Organisational Unit responsible for the non-capital asset subject to One Up Authorisation (Also refer JCU Code of Conduct).

  • The Head of the Organisational Unit must identify all non-capital assets excess to the Organisational Unit's operating requirements at least annually and dispose of them in accordance with FMPM 323: Procedures – Disposal of Plant & Equipment.

  • The disposal of a non-capital asset to any employee or associate of the University must not disadvantage the University (Refer FMPM 323: Procedures – Disposal of Plant & Equipment).
